Transaction 1717cb29ace8cf6e851cfd9da41336c29e78b6f6b6881fc618a7c2dc55480590
1 Input
1 Output
-
1717cb29ace8cf6e851cfd9da41336c29e78b6f6b6881fc618a7c2dc55480590:0
- value
- 11401465
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62cf520976cc775cae2e822bf5e3bce34ed5825e OP_EQUAL
- address
- 3AhUWDmkSK2EkfjnFKmBx4tZtsKmZqS5pn